summaryrefslogtreecommitdiffstats
path: root/lib/network/connection_manager.pm
diff options
context:
space:
mode:
Diffstat (limited to 'lib/network/connection_manager.pm')
-rw-r--r--lib/network/connection_manager.pm4
1 files changed, 2 insertions, 2 deletions
diff --git a/lib/network/connection_manager.pm b/lib/network/connection_manager.pm
index d96192f..21019c5 100644
--- a/lib/network/connection_manager.pm
+++ b/lib/network/connection_manager.pm
@@ -446,8 +446,8 @@ sub setup_dbus_handlers {
sub {
my ($_con, $msg) = @_;
my $member = $msg->get_member;
- my $message = _get_network_event_message($droam, $member, $msg->get_args_list) or return;
- $on_network_event->($message) if $on_network_event;
+ my $message = _get_network_event_message($droam, $member, $msg->get_args_list);
+ $on_network_event->($message) if $on_network_event && $message;
$droam->update_networks if $member eq 'status';
});
$dbus->{connection}->add_match("type='signal',interface='com.mandriva.network'");